What is a TFT LCD Module?
A TFT LCD Module (Thin-Film Transistor Liquid Crystal Display) is an active matrix display that uses thin-film transistor technology to improve image quality. Each pixel on a TFT LCD has its own dedicated transistor, allowing precise control over brightness and color. This results in faster response times, higher contrast ratios, and better viewing angles compared to passive matrix displays. The module typically includes the LCD panel, driver ICs, backlight unit, and often a touch panel or interface board. TFT LCD modules are available in sizes ranging from small 1-inch displays for wearables to large 15-inch panels for industrial HMI systems. Key Benefits of TFT LCD Modules
The TFT LCD Module offers numerous advantages that make it a preferred choice for designers and manufacturers. First, its excellent color reproduction and high brightness ensure readability even under direct sunlight, which is crucial for outdoor kiosks and automotive displays. Second, TFT LCD modules consume relatively low power compared to older technologies, making them ideal for battery-powered devices. Third, the wide operating temperature range (-20°C to +70°C or wider) allows deployment in harsh industrial environments. Fourth, TFT LCD modules support various interfaces like RGB, LVDS, MIPI, and HDMI, simplifying integration with different microcontrollers and processors. Finally, the long lifespan of LED backlights (typically 50,000 hours or more) reduces maintenance costs. How to Select the Right TFT LCD Module
Choosing the correct TFT LCD Module for your project requires careful consideration of several factors. Start by determining the required display size and resolution based on the viewing distance and content complexity. Next, evaluate the brightness level needed for the ambient lighting conditions; outdoor applications typically require 800-1000 nits or higher. Interface compatibility is another critical aspect—ensure the module supports the same protocol as your main controller. Consider the viewing angle requirements; IPS (In-Plane Switching) technology provides wider angles than standard TN panels. Also, check the operating temperature range if the device will be used in extreme environments. Finally, decide whether you need a touch panel (resistive or capacitive) and whether it should be integrated or separate. Types of TFT LCD Modules
The TFT LCD Module market offers several variations to meet different needs. Standard TFT LCD modules come with TN (Twisted Nematic) panels that offer fast response times and lower cost but narrower viewing angles. IPS TFT LCD modules provide superior color consistency and wider viewing angles, ideal for high-end applications. Some modules include built-in touch functionality, either resistive (cost-effective, works with gloves) or capacitive (multi-touch, better sensitivity). There are also sunlight-readable TFT LCD modules with higher brightness and optical bonding to reduce glare. Future Trends in TFT LCD Module Technology
The TFT LCD Module industry continues to evolve with emerging technologies. One major trend is the adoption of Mini-LED backlighting, which provides higher contrast and local dimming for improved HDR performance. Another development is the integration of TFT LCD with touch and cover glass in a single bonded assembly, reducing thickness and improving durability. The demand for flexible TFT LCD modules is also growing, allowing curved displays for automotive interiors and wearable devices. Additionally, manufacturers are focusing on reducing power consumption through advanced driver ICs and energy-efficient backlights. Frequently Asked Questions About TFT LCD Modules
- What is the difference between TFT LCD and OLED? TFT LCD uses a backlight to illuminate liquid crystals, while OLED pixels emit their own light. OLED offers deeper blacks and thinner profiles, but TFT LCD provides longer lifespan and lower cost for larger sizes.
- Can I use a TFT LCD module outdoors? Yes, but you need a module with high brightness (800-1000 nits minimum) and anti-glare treatment. Sunlight-readable TFT LCD modules are specifically designed for outdoor use.
- What interfaces do TFT LCD modules support? Common interfaces include RGB (parallel), LVDS, MIPI DSI, HDMI, and SPI. The choice depends on your processor or controller capabilities.
- How long does a TFT LCD module last? Typical LED backlight lifetime is 30,000 to 100,000 hours, depending on brightness and operating conditions. The LCD panel itself can last much longer if properly driven.

- What is the operating temperature range for TFT LCD modules? Standard modules operate from -20°C to +70°C. Extended temperature versions can work from -30°C to +85°C for industrial applications.

- How do I interface a TFT LCD module with a microcontroller? Most modules include a driver board that handles timing and voltage. You connect using the appropriate interface pins and configure your MCU to send display data.
- What is the typical resolution of a TFT LCD module? Resolutions range from 320x240 (QVGA) to 1920x1080 (Full HD) and beyond. Choose based on your content and viewing distance.
